Vardenafil, commonly known by its brand name Levitra, is a medication primarily used to treat erectile dysfunction (ED) in men. When taken correctly, Vardenafil can significantly improve sexual performance and confidence. However, like any medication, it is essential to understand how to use it properly for optimal results.

Dosage Instructions for Vardenafil
When taking Vardenafil, adhering to the prescribed dosage is crucial. Below are the general steps and guidelines for taking Vardenafil effectively:
- Consult Your Doctor: Before starting Vardenafil, consult your healthcare provider to determine the appropriate dosage based on your health condition and other medications you may be taking.
- Dosage Forms: Vardenafil is available in tablet form, typically taken orally. The common starting dose is 10 mg, but it can range from 5 mg to 20 mg based on individual response and tolerability.
- Timing: Take Vardenafil approximately 30 minutes to an hour before planned sexual activity. The effects usually last for about 4 to 5 hours.
- Food Considerations: Vardenafil can be taken with or without food. However, it is advisable to avoid heavy or high-fat meals, as they may delay the onset of action.
- Do Not Exceed the Recommended Dose: Do not take more than one dose within 24 hours to avoid potential overdose and side effects.
Precautions and Side Effects
While Vardenafil is generally safe, it is essential to be aware of potential side effects, which may include:
- Headaches
- Flushing
- Stomach upset
- Back pain
- Nasal congestion
If you experience severe side effects or an allergic reaction, seek immediate medical attention. Always inform your doctor of your medical history before commencing treatment with Vardenafil.
